2 cents here...
As far as I remember, OB is 10K Ohms (at 25degrees C), MidNite is 10K,
Magnum is 100K and Xantrex/Trace/Schneider is 100K
Magnum has a couple of swapped lines compared to the other BTS' but ~may~ or may not
work for others in some instances.
